Adventure Tips

Wear layered clothing

Wyoming weather can change quickly, so packing layers ensures comfort throughout the day.

Bring your camera with extra batteries

Capturing wildlife photos requires a well-charged camera, especially during extended observation periods.

Stay quiet and patient

Wildlife is more likely to approach if visitors remain silent and patient during tours.

Use sun protection

S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ses help protect against strong Wyoming sun during outdoor excursions.
